What are Incident Report Form Templates?

Incident Report Form Templates are pre-designed documents that allow users to record and report details of accidents, incidents, or other unwanted occurrences. These templates help to standardize the information gathered and ensure that important details are not overlooked.

What are the types of Incident Report Form Templates?

There are various types of Incident Report Form Templates available to cater to different industries and settings. Some common types include:

Employee incident report forms
Workplace accident report forms
Medical incident report forms
Security incident report forms

How to complete Incident Report Form Templates

Completing Incident Report Form Templates is essential to ensuring accurate and thorough documentation of incidents. Follow these steps to effectively complete an Incident Report Form:

01
Fill in the date, time, and location of the incident
02
Provide a detailed description of the incident and any contributing factors
03
Include personal details and contact information of individuals involved or witnesses
04
Attach any relevant photos, documents, or evidence to support the report

An incident report form is used to provide a comprehensive record of any unwelcome or undesirable occurrence that occurs within the workplace environment. This includes such things as workplace accidents, hazardous material spills, safety violations or misconduct by employees.
An incident report should include the following details: The person affected and their contact information. A factual description of the incident, including location, date, and time. A description of the incurred injuries if any.

The key tasks to mention in the workflow includes notification of the incident, identification of responsible, interviews, investigation and analysis, conclusion, sharing learnings and implementation.
Include details about what happened before the incident, the incident itself, and actions that were taken immediately after. If you are writing down your opinion of what caused the incident or what you think happened, be sure to note that it is an assumption.
